dc.descriptionThis clinical case was developed with the purpose of describing acute renal failure, which mainly affects people with underlying diseases such as diabetes, cardiovascular pathologies or obesity. The Nursing Care Process was applied to a 60-year-old patient who presented oliguria, dysuria, hyperthermia 38.2ºC, edema in the lower limbs, pain in the lumbar region, vertigo and asthenia. Vital signs were monitored, where blood pressure was 140/89 mmHg. The patient's medical history confirmed a diagnosis of hypertension approximately 2 years ago. The interview confirmed that the patient had poor medication control. After performing a cephalocaudal assessment, Marjory Gordon's altered functional patterns were identified, which were immediately treated by the nursing staff based on the nursing diagnosis (NANDA), classification of outcomes (NOC) and classification of nursing interventions (NIC). The patient remains hospitalized in the internal medicine area for further monitoring and follow-up, and under the direct care of the nursing staff.es_ES

dc.description.abstractEl presente caso clínico se elaboró con la finalidad de describir la insuficiencia renal aguda que afecta mayormente a personas con enfermedades subyacente como lo es la diabetes, patologías cardiovasculares u obesidad. Se aplicó el Proceso Atención de enfermería a paciente de 60 años por presentar oliguria, disuria, hipertermia 38,2ºC, edemas en miembros inferiores, dolor en región lumbar, vértigo y astenia. Se realiza monitorización de signos vitales donde refiere presion arterial 140/89mmHg. En los antecedentes se corrobora diagnóstico de hipertensión hace aproximadamente 2 años. En la entrevista se confirma que el paciente ha llevado un mal control en la medicación. Tras realizar valoración cefalocaudal se identifican los patrones funcionales alterados de Marjory Gordon que fueron tratados de inmediato por el personal de enfermería que se basó en el diagnóstico enfermero (NANDA), clasificación de los resultados (NOC) y clasificación de intervenciones de enfermería (NIC). Paciente queda hospitalizado en el área de medicina interna para mayor control y seguimiento, y bajo el cuidado directo del personal de enfermería.es_ES
